Wednesday, the Louisiana Department of Wildlife and Fisheries issued an official news release recommending “deer hunters not utilize supplemental feeds as this increases the chance of spreading diseases among deer using bait stations, including chronic wasting disease (CWD). Here are your 2018 Crappie Masters National Champions, Matthew Rogers and Baylor Mead. They are the winners of $34,100.00 in cash which included the Missouri Corn and American Ethanol $2000.00 bonus for using E10 Fuel in their boat. The Louisiana Department of Wildlife and Fisheries (LDWF) will host National Hunting and Fishing Day (NHFD) events tomorrow — Saturday, Sept. 22 — in four locations throughout the state, including West Monroe.
